What are you in gymnastics for?

What are you in gymnastics for? Are you hoping to become elite? Are you hoping to get a college schloarship? What level are you now and how old are you?

Ok so I just turned 14 on Sunday and I am a level 8. I'm not gonna be elite or anything since I only practice 9.5 hours a week. I want to do gymnastics in college but I'm not gonna get a full ride on gymnastics or anything. I started competing level 4 when I was 8. Then I had two years in 5. 1 year in 6. 1 in 7. and I'm going to have at least 2 years in 8. Right now this is my first year.
